Rockfall Engineering is an up-to-date, international picture of the state of the art in rockfall engineering.
The three basic stages of rockfalls are considered: the triggering stage, the motion stage, and the interaction with a structure stage; along with contributions including structural characterization of cliffs, remote monitoring, stability analysis, boulder propagation, design of protection structures an risk assessment.
Academic contributions are illustrated by practical examples, and completed by engineering contributions where practical purposes are thoroughly considered. This title is intended for engineers, students as well as researchers.

Stéphane Lambert is a Research Engineer at CEMAGREF, Grenoble, France. His research are mainly on protection structures, natural hazards and geosynthetics.
François Nicot is a Researcher at CEMAGREF, Grenoble, France, and an Executive Member of the International Society for Soil Mechanics and Geotechnical Engineering (ISSMGE). His contributions mainly concern the mechanical behavior of granular geomaterials. He is also Editor-in-chief of the European Journal of Environmental and Civil Engineering.
